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: [php] Jak wykonać expotr danych do Open Office Calc ?
Forum PHP.pl > Forum > PHP
rafaelb
Czy ktoś może wie jak wykonać export danych od OppenOffice Calc ?

Do MS Excel robie to tak. Tworze tabelkę html i wysyłam ją podając wcześniej odpowiednie nagłówki tj.
  1. <?php
  2. header("Content-Transfer-Encoding: base64");
  3. header("Content-Type: text/multipart");
  4. header("Content-Type: application/vnd.ms-excel");
  5. header("Content-Disposition: attachment; filename=raport.xls");
  6. header("Pragma: private");
  7. header("Expires: 0");
  8. header("Cache-Control: private, must-revalidate");
  9. print $tresc_xls;
  10. ?>


Wszystko ładnie działa, używam tego już jakiś czas. Zgłasza sie okienko dialogowe i mam możliwość zapisu bądź otworzenia w Excelu.
Po zapisaniu pliku na dysk i próbie otworzenia przez OpenOffice Calc -> plik Otweira Mi OO Writer (odpowiednik MS Word). Domyślam sie że tak się dzieje, ponieważ defakto ten plik raport.xls jest plikiem html.

Czy ktoś ma jakieś rozwiązanie ?
Kocurro
I need code ... much more code ... without code I can't anything to you ... winksmiley.jpg
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.